​Duck and Run 5K Registration Open

Picture
​The Duck and Run 5K will take place on Saturday, September 21st at 7:00 a.m. in Athens.  

This is the 16th year for this race which supports the projects and programs of Keep Athens-Limestone Beautiful, and is one of their most important fundraisers.

Early registration is...

... $20.  Late and race day registration will be $25.  Registration forms are available at the KALB office at 125 East St. in Athens, or online registration can be found at www.Raceroster.com.  For race details or a printable form, visit www.KALBCares.com and click on the EVENTS tab.

The Duck and Run 5K is a great race for both seasoned runners and beginners.  The course is mildly challenging and will take runners through tree-lined streets and past antebgellum homes in the Athens Historic Districts as well as around the Courthouse Square.  Start and finish points will be at Big Spring Memorial Park in Athens.

The first 300 runners will receive a goody bag and a Duck and Run t-shirt provided by many generous sponsors.  American Leakless Company, the event’s Diamond Duck sponsor, will be providing an aluminum water bottle to the first 300 registrants.

Excellent refreshments will be available after the race in and around the historic Athens Visitors Center, which was built in 1906 and served as the Athens Utilities Building.  Cash prizes and trophies in several age categories will be awarded along with gift cards from Fleet Feet, another very generous supporter of this 5K.
This race has one of the lowest registration fees, and KALB offers a special low registration fee to local cross-country teams who might want to use this race for practice.  Anyone interested in registering a cross-country team should contact KALB for more information.

Race Supports Environmental Education

Because of many amazing sponsors, every penny of the registration fees goes directly to support the KALB organization’s projects and programs.  Although KALB has a variety of activities, the most important is education.  

KALB staff love to be invited into classrooms from preschool through 6th grade.  By invitation, Sparky and The Talking Tree will visit the younger students to discuss litter, recycling, and the importance of trees to our world.  KALB has a variety of classroom presentations that are geared toward any age group.  A student favorite is a game of Environmental Jeopardy where student teams compete against each other.

Speakers are also available for adult groups and clubs.
